Considerations in Epimerization of Sterane and Triterpane as Indicators of Thermal History of Sedimentrary Rocks

24 mudstone samples from Shinjo Oil Field and Nishiyama Oil Field (Neogene Tertiary, Japan) were examined by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ry to investigate the extent of configurational isomerization (epimerization) of the so-called biological marker compounds (steranes and triterpanes).The increases of the ratios of 20S/20R-24-ethyl-5α(H), 14α(H), 17α(H)-cholestane and of 22S/22R-17α(H), 21β(H)-bishomohopane (C32) with maturation were recognized clearly. However, it was also recognized that the rate of epimerization of sterane was relatively higher than of triterpane in two sedimentary Basin in Japan in comparison with Paris Basin (France), Uinta Basin (U. S. A.) and Bohai Bay Basin (China). It was considered that the effect of the difference of heating rate among the sedimentary Basins appeared. That is, higher rates of epimerization of sterane than of triterpane in Japanese two Basins are possiblly due to relatively higher heating rates which are attributable to high geothermal gradients and high rates of burial.In addition, the evaluation of the level of maturation by the equivalent reaction temperature and equivalent reaction time, which would be determined by the two kinetic parameters such as the extent of epimerization of sterane and triterpane, was proposed based on the kinetic considerations in this paper.
